Daliso Chaponda Brings Comedy Tour to Newcastle's Stand
The Malawian born stand up Daliso Chaponda has announced a Newcastle show at The Stand Comedy Club on 11th November. He has performed all over the world, including two UK-wide tours and at the Edinburgh, Melbourne, Singapore and Cape Town comedy festivals. Daliso shot to fame and captured the hearts of the nation on Britain’s Got Talent 2017where he reached the final and was Amanda Holden’s Golden Buzzer act. He has goneon to amass an outstanding 300 million plus YouTube & Facebook views!
Last November he performed on The Royal Variety Performance (ITV1) with other notable TV appearances under his belt that include three appearances on QI (BBC2) and is a series regular on the Apprentice You're Fired (BBC2). He is also due to appear on this years Rhod Gilbert's Growning Pains for Comedy Central.
His Radio 4 show ‘Citizen Of Nowhere’, which he wrote and stars in,is back for a third series this October. His last stand-up show ‘Blah Blah Blacklist’ received critical acclaim from the Edinburgh Festival and his previous show ‘What The African Said’ sold out a 50 + date UK tour and also received much critical praise.
In addition to Stand up Comedy, Daliso is also a prolific fiction writer. He has published science fiction and was a finalist in the ‘Writers of The Future’ competition run by L. Ron Hubbard publishing based in the USA and he has had his murder mysteries and fantasy fiction in numerous magazines and anthologies.
